The Crédit Agricole SA Group applies CSR sector policies based on key criteria for a just energy transition. These criteria make it possible to orient the Group's financing and investment portfolios.
Crédit Agricole Group's CSR sector policies
The CSR sector policies published by the Group explain the social, environmental and societal criteria introduced in its financing and investment policies. These criteria essentially reflect the civic issues that seem most relevant for all of the Bank's activities, and in particular with regard to respect for human rights, the fight against climate change and the preservation of biodiversity. The aim of sectoral CSR policies is thus to specify the principles and rules of extra-financial intervention concerning financing and investments in the sectors concerned.
